Ordinals
beta
Sat 770673368119754
decimal
154134.3368119754
degree
0°154134′918″3368119754‴
percentile
36.698731855595%
name
ijuqrvaxzoh
cycle
0
epoch
0
period
76
block
154134
offset
3368119754
timestamp
2011-11-20 21:49:47 UTC
rarity
common
prev
next